Impossible Made Possible!

"I'm my own person!"
"I scraped and worked hard and made a success of myself!"
"Look at what I have made of myself!"
"I can straighten myself out! I don't need anyone else!"

These are all the statements of the arrogant who would like to think they do not need anyone else, including God. They are the statements of those who are thinking too highly of themselves. If mankind were so smart to straighten out life's problems, then why is this world in such a mess? Why does there continue to be a lack of peace? Why do nations and individuals not get along? Because too many think they are smart enough to fix it all without the aid or wisdom of God. But the fact is WE NEED GOD!

Following a discussion Jesus had with a rich young man of whom there was the need to realize how riches can get in the way of man, His disciples asked the question . . .

"...'WHO THEN CAN BE SAVED?'" (Mathew 19:25 ESV)

In the next verse we read Jesus' response.

"But Jesus looked at them and said, 'WITH MAN THIS IS IMPOSSIBLE, BUT WITH GOD ALL THINGS ARE POSSIBLE.'" ( Matthew 19:26 ESV)

It is God who makes our salvation possible. We cannot save ourselves. God must be in the picture. God must be a part of our lives. We need His help and His wisdom to change the things in our lives that need changing and keep us going the direction that will ultimately lead us to eternity with Him. WE CANNOT DO IT OURSELVES! IT IS (in the words of Jesus) "IMPOSSIBLE"! But it is ALL POSSIBLE WITH GOD!

Thank God for making the IMPOSSIBLE for us POSSIBLE! May we keep our focus on Him and His Will. It will not only benefit our life and relationships now, but our eternity also depends on it.
